SCA: security update for org.apache.qpid:qpid-broker (GHSA-269m-695x-j34p)

critical Tenable Cloud Security Plugin ID 423219

Description

There are packages installed that are affected by a vulnerability referenced in the following CVE:

- In Apache Qpid Broker-J 0.18 through 0.32, if the broker is configured with different authentication
providers on different ports one of which is an HTTP port, then the broker can be tricked by a remote
unauthenticated attacker connecting to the HTTP port into using an authentication provider that was
configured on a different port. The attacker still needs valid credentials with the authentication
provider on the spoofed port. This becomes an issue when the spoofed port has weaker authentication
protection (e.g., anonymous access, default accounts) and is normally protected by firewall rules or
similar which can be circumvented by this vulnerability. AMQP ports are not affected. Versions 6.0.0 and
newer are not affected. (CVE-2017-15702)
